What problem does it solve?

Identify meaningful connections between notes and update MOCs to reflect new relationships, turning a collection of notes into an actionable knowledge graph.

Core Features & Use Cases

  • Surface and surface relationships between notes using both curated topic maps and semantic similarity search.
  • Update topic maps and MOCs with new connections while maintaining articulation tests and evidence for each link.
  • Support synthesis across topics by identifying tensions, gaps, and higher-order insights.
